
In the event there are no nuts then it’s up to the installer to connect the wires as close as possible to the alternator’s main power output. If the protection device cable is on top of the live cable (not held in by the live cable) then, when the device cable falls off, the alternator will not be protected. If the tensioning nut on the main cable becomes loose the main cable will fall off first leaving the protection device on the alternator, this will save the alternator. For maximum protection remove the main cables after (thus sandwiching in the protection cable). There will already be the main alternator outputs on the alternator’s stud. It’s always best to connect the device ring terminal to the inside of the bolts of the alternator’s main power cables. Simply connect the positive/negative output connection from the protection device to the positive/negative output of the alternator. (We do not supply any cables with the protection device, we recommend the use of a 10A cable (place device as near to alternator as possible) The 12V or 24V alternator open circuit protection device is designed to absorb spikes in excess of 18V (12V) and 36V (24V systems). Most alternator regulators and internal diode packs will be damaged by spikes in excess of 40V.

This is effective from full power to no power fault events on the alternator. Someone switching off engine’s electrical power when engine is actually running.ĭefective rotary battery selection switch causing arcing during rotation.įailure of a fuse if fitted in the alternator’s circuit.Īll of the above events could easily destroy your alternator’s sensitive parts, this device will prevent this by diverting any high spike build up to earth. Loose wires causing an alternator wire to become undone/loose causing sparking.įailure in a split diode/relay charging system, open circuiting this system. Most common faults which cause this problem are: It prevents extreme damage occurring to your main and auxiliary system devices. The 12V or 24V alternator open circuit protection device is a highly effective alternator protection device which prevents high voltage back EMF spikes from destroying your alternator’s expensive regulator and internal diode pack. Works with any alternator or splitting device (12V or 24V). Does not carry the main current so only light wiring is required Simple safe emergency route for that spike to be discharged giving full protection to the alternator’s regulator. Protects alternator from massive spikes caused when a cable is loose or a fuse blows.
